Disappointment as hundreds of City fans already in Brighton when game called off
Less than two hours before kick off Brighton v Cardiff City has been called off due to heavy fog in the area.
My journey down to the south coast involed fog from Berkshire onwards, speaking to the locals they say it's been foggy all day in Brighton, so why no information earlier from the club?
While ticket costs will be refunded to those who can't make the re-arranged game, there are many of us left out of pocket after a wasted journey.
The referee below states the reasons for the postponement, and you can't legislate against the weather, but I feel Brighton could have given the travlleing fans a bit more warning and allowed them to make a decision about turning around.
